Finesse Your Horsemanship at the Ranch This Fall

0919_04

The 10-day Intermediate Clinic held at the Downunder Horsemanship Ranch, November 10th – 20th offers participants the chance to learn and refine the 30 plus groundwork and riding exercises that make up the second level of the Method. Horsemen will receive one-on-one help to gain more control of the horse’s feet on the ground and achieve softness and suppleness through the horse’s whole body under saddle.

The clinic will run from 9 a.m. to 5 p.m. daily and include a two-hour lunch break. The coursework will take place in the arena, on the obstacle course and on the trail.
